Find LCM of 926,789,369,690,828 with Prime Factorization


2 926, 789, 369, 690, 828
3 463, 789, 369, 345, 414
3 463, 263, 123, 115, 138
23 463, 263, 41, 115, 46
463, 263, 41, 5, 2

Multiply the prime numbers at the bottom and the left side.

2 x 3 x 3 x 23 x 463 x 263 x 41 x 5 x 2 = 20669070060

Therefore, the lowest common multiple of 926,789,369,690,828 is 20669070060.
